Title :
An adaptive IIR structure for sinusoidal enhancement, frequency estimation, and detection

Abstract :
An adaptive IIR structure for processing a sinusoidal signal in broad-band noise is introduced. The structure contains three adaptive processors, each of which is computationally very simple. Useful features of the structure include enhancement, frequency estimation, and detection.
